Samsung has announced that it will hold an online Galaxy Event on September 4 to unveil fresh Galaxy hardware and a further push for Galaxy AI. The company said the livestream will begin at 11:30 am CEST (3:00 pm IST), and you can watch on Samsung.com or the official Samsung YouTube channel.
New S25 FE and premium Tab S11 tablets headline the show
Samsung is putting Galaxy AI front and centre, while the hardware slate looks familiar from recent leaks. The headline phone is expected to be the Galaxy S25 FE, which reportedly comes with a 6.7 inch Full HD plus Dynamic AMOLED 2X display, a 120Hz refresh rate and roughly 382 pixels per inch.
Under the hood the S25 FE appears to use Samsung’s own Exynos 2400 rather than a Snapdragon chip, paired with about 8GB of RAM and 128GB of storage.

Software will arrive on day one, with Android 16 and One UI 8 preinstalled. Camera rumours point to a triple rear array led by a 50MP main sensor. Battery capacity is said to be about 4,900mAh with 45 watt wired charging and 25W wireless charging reported.
On the tablet side Samsung looks set to introduce the Galaxy Tab S11 series, likely consisting of a Tab S11 and a Tab S11 Ultra, with no Plus model this year. Reports place MediaTek Dimensity 9400 class chips inside these tablets, which will also ship with Android 16 and One UI 8 and lean heavily on AI features and tighter integration across Galaxy devices.
